Is there any guidance about how soon after receiving a favorable determination letter on a plan termination that a defined contribution plan must make distributions? (It appears to me that it is currently 120 days for a DB plan in a standard termination, but I have not seen DC plan guidance).
Take a look at Rev. Rul. 89-87. As far as I know it applies equally to all plan terminations,so unless you have some unusual circumstances such as assets difficult to value or dispose of,or a participant who can't be located,I'd use one year from the date of termination as the final distribution date.
